The Erne River, which widens into the extensive and beautiful Lough Erne, divides Fermanagh into two roughly equal parts. A hilly terrain, rising to more than 2,000 ft (610 m) in the south, is devoted largely to grazing. Farming (potatoes, beef and dairy cattle) is important to the local economy. Fermanagha county in Northern Ireland (Great Britain), in the basin of Lough Erne and Upper Lough Erne. Area, 1,700 sq km. Population, 50,300 (1971). The principal city is Enniskillen. Fermanagh is an agricultural region, where meat and dairy cattle are raised. Fermanagh |
